Workers in manufacturing environments face a higher risk of injury, particularly musculoskeletal disorders, due to the repetitive and physically demanding tasks common in the industry. As organizations continue to prioritize workplace safety, new technologies are creating opportunities to better identify risks and support safer work practices.
